Dawn redwood trees that turned bright red and orange drew visitors to a cultural and tourist destination in Xiantao, Hubei province. The area represents a distinctive environment with trees growing in water, birds nestling in trees and fish swimming in lakes.

The 73-hectare tourism site includes 31 hectares covered with water, dotted by around 20,000 dawn redwood trees.

Also known as the metasequoia, the tree is native to China and widely regarded as a living fossil since its existence dates back to the Cretaceous period.
